Best HVAC Systems for Commercial Buildings

Choosing the right HVAC system for your business building can lead to significant lasting cost savings. Look for systems that are energy-efficient and have actually progressed attributes such as variable speed motors or smart thermostats. A few of the best choices consist of:

    Variable Cooling agent Flow (VRF) Systems: These systems permit simultaneous cooling and heating in different areas, making them best for huge workplace buildings. Geothermal Heat Pumps: Utilizing the planet's all-natural temperature level aids decrease power consumption. High-Efficiency Roof Units (RTUs): Suitable for smaller industrial areas, these systems typically feature built-in energy-saving technologies.

How to Reduce HVAC Power Costs in Industrial Properties

Regular Upkeep: Follow a rigorous preventative maintenance schedule for your HVAC system. Regular check-ups make sure every little thing functions efficiently and can avoid unexpected breakdowns.

Upgrade Insulation: Well-insulated buildings retain warm in winter season and cool air in summertime, decreasing the work on your HVAC system.

Install Programmable Thermostats: These devices permit you to establish certain temperature levels throughout functioning hours and adjust instantly after hours, ensuring you're not losing power when no person is around.

Utilize All-natural Ventilation: Whenever possible, open windows instead of relying upon cooling-- this saves energy while offering fresh air.

Seal Ductwork: Leaking air ducts can waste approximately 30% of heated or cooled air. Guarantee that all seams are secured effectively to take full advantage of efficiency.

Implement Zoning Systems: With HVAC zoning systems for office buildings, you can produce various temperature level zones according to certain needs as opposed to cooling or heating up a whole area unnecessarily.

Signs Your Commercial HVAC System Requirements Repair

Being proactive concerning repair services can save you cash over time. Watch out for these signs:

    Uneven temperatures across various areas Unusual noises from the unit Increased energy expenses without a clear reason Frequent cycling on and off Unpleasant odors originating from vents

If you discover any one of these warnings, it might be time to talk to a specialist regarding prospective repairs or replacements.

Green HVAC Solutions for Industrial Spaces

In today's eco-conscious world, consider incorporating green solutions into your structure's framework:

    Energy Recovery Ventilators (ERVs): These systems recycle exhaust air to precondition incoming fresh air. Solar-Powered air conditioner Systems: Making use of renewable resource resources minimizes reliance on conventional electricity. Smart Sensors: These tools readjust heating and cooling based upon tenancy levels, ensuring ideal efficiency at all times.

Commercial HVAC Setup Guide

When installing a new system or updating an existing one, follow this overview:

Assess Your Requirements: Take into consideration building dimension, format, number of passengers, and details use cases. Choose Energy-Efficient Designs: Choose products with high SEER ratings (Seasonal Energy Efficiency Ratio). Ensure Correct Sizing: An incorrectly sized system can cause inadequacies-- seek specialist advice if uncertain about sizing requirements. Plan Ductwork Format Wisely: Improperly created ductwork can trigger air movement issues; purchase quality design upfront. Schedule Professional Installment: Appropriate setup is crucial-- constantly employ competent technicians.
